French Monetary and Financial CodeIn force
Chapter III: Common provisions

Article L123-1

Banknotes and coins are protected as intellectual works by articles L. 122-4 and L. 335-2 of the French Intellectual Property Code. The issuing authorities are vested with the author's rights.
